Highest Honor for Inova Nurses

Inova Alexandria and Inova Mount Vernon hospitals pursue Magnet designation

Nurses are an integral part of patient care, and honoring the work they do is an important part of Inova’s culture. For this reason, Inova Alexandria (IAH) and Inova Mount Vernon (IMVH) hospitals are pursuing the prestigious Magnet® designation.

Awarded by the American Nurses Credentialing Center (ANCC), Magnet recognizes an organization’s commitment to supporting and advancing nursing excellence, as well as delivering quality patient care and promoting safety. To date, nearly 500 of the approximately 5,000 hospitals in the United States have achieved Magnet status. Because the designation will benefit the hospitals and their communities — from physicians to patients — we’re asking everyone to be “all in for Magnet!”

IAH is well on its way to Magnet designation. In December 2018, it achieved the ANCC Pathway to Excellence Designation, which recognizes a healthcare organization’s commitment to creating an environment that empowers and engages staff. IAH is the first in the Inova system to receive this designation. IMVH’s Magnet journey began in earnest in May, when the hospital announced its formal plans to achieve this designation during its annual nursing awards dinner. The goal for reaching Magnet is 2021 for both hospitals.

Residents of Inova’s East Region have been longtime supporters of nursing. “We are so grateful to this community for supporting our nurses on their journey for continued growth and professional development,” says Maureen Sintich, DNP, MBA, RN, WHNP-BC, Inova Chief Nurse Executive. “These gifts provide scholarships, continuing education, research opportunities and leadership development for nurses at both of these hospitals.”
